The NXP LPC54605J256ET100E is a 32-bit ARM Cortex-M4 single-core MCU running at 180 MHz, with 256 KB of Flash and 136 KB of RAM on a 100-TFBGA package. It's built for mid-complexity control and connectivity tasks — think motor drives, industrial I/O nodes, or HMI front-ends where you need USB and a handful of serial interfaces without stepping up to a bigger part. The 180 MHz clock gives you headroom for tight control loops or moderate DSP work; the 136 KB RAM keeps a decent buffer for packet handling or display frame storage.
The 64 I/O pins give enough flexibility for parallel displays or a moderate sensor array.
